Vilsack To Keynote 2012 Commodity Classic

Tom Vilsack

Commodity Classic organizers announced Secretary of Agriculture Tom Vilsack will join the annual convention again in 2012 as a keynote speaker.

The 2012 Commodity Classic is scheduled for March 1 to 3, 2012, in Nashville, Tenn., with National Association of Wheat Growers policy committee meetings beginning Feb. 29.

The annual event is the nation’s largest farmer-led, farmer-focused conference and trade show, and is the annual convention for NAWG, the National Corn Growers Association, the American Soybean Association and the National Sorghum Producers.

The event offers a wide range of learning and networking opportunities for growers in the areas of production, policy, marketing, management and stewardship, and showcases the latest in equipment, technology and innovation.

In making the announcement about Vilsack’s attendance, Classic organizers said they expect more than 4,800 farmers and other attendees during the event’s general session, where Vilsack is set to speak on March 1.

While Classic is still months away, planners are already deeply engaged in preparing for the conference.

Among other things, NAWG is again working with U.S. Wheat Associates and the Wheat Foods Council to put together an educational and entertaining booth for the Classic trade show. The NAWG Foundation is planning to sponsor a learning center session, like it has done in years past.

Additional details about NAWG and Classic events, and more information about registration and housing for the convention, will be available before the end of the year.
